As a planeswalker, you are someone of magical talents, whether or not you know how to cast magic does not prevent you from having a Spark. Normally, through the power of your spark, would have near omnipotence, incredible power and the ability to travel the multiverse with ease, but after an event known as the Mending, you have either lost your Spark or were severely depowered and the abilities that seperated you from the average magic user have become null and void. for those that have either gained a Spark, retained their Spark, or somehow managed to regained their lost Spark, the only thing that seperates them from other mages is the ability to travel the Multiverse.
Suggested Characteristics
| d8 | Personality Trait |
|---|---|
| 1 | I don’t pay attention to the risks in a situation. Never tell me the odds. |
| 2 | I am incredibly slow to trust. Those who seem the fairest often have the most to hide. |
| 3 | I’m haunted by memories of war. I can’t get the images of violence out of my mind. |
| 4 | I enjoy being strong and like breaking things. |
| 5 | I’ve read every book in the world’s greatest libraries—or I like to boast that I have. |
| 6 | I’m willing to listen to every side of an argument before I make my own judgment |
| 7 | I know a story relevant to almost every situation. |
| 8 | Whenever I come to a new place, I collect local rumors and spread gossip. |
| d6 | Ideal |
|---|---|
| 1 | Freedom. Tyrants must not be allowed to oppress the people. (Chaotic) |
| 2 | Tradition. The stories, legends, and songs of the past must never be forgotten, for they teach us who we are. (Lawful) |
| 3 | Aspiration. I seek to prove myself worthy of my god’s favor by matching my actions against his or her teachings. (Any) |
| 4 | Power. The only way to get ahead in this world is to attain power and hold onto it with all your might. (Evil) |
| 5 | Sincerity. There’s no good in pretending to be something I’m not. (Neutral) |
| 6 | Live and Let Live. Ideals aren’t worth killing over or going to war for. (Neutral) |
| d6 | Bond |
|---|---|
| 1 | Those who fight beside me are those worth dying for |
| 2 | I sold my soul for knowledge. I hope to do great deeds and win it back. |
| 3 | I’m guilty of a terrible crime. I hope I can redeem myself for it. |
| 4 | I will bring terrible wrath down on the evildoers who destroyed my homeland. |
| 5 | I’ll never forget the crushing defeat my company suffered or the enemies who dealt it. |
| 6 | My parents worry about me, but I’ll make them proud. |
| d6 | Flaw |
|---|---|
| 1 | If people find me unpleasant, that’s their problem. |
| 2 | I am suspicious of strangers and expect the worst of them. |
| 3 | Once I start drinking, it’s hard for me to stop. |
| 4 | I’d rather eat my armor than admit when I’m wrong. |
| 5 | Despite my best efforts, I am unreliable to my friends. |
| 6 | Flaw? I have no flaws. I’m perfect |
